Paul Vi Catholic High School is a coeducational private Catholic traditional school for students in grades 9 through 12.
Paul VI Catholic High School offers students the opportunity to develop spiritually, intellectually, personally, socially, and physically through a varied program of required and elective classes, as well as extra-curricular organizations and athletic teams. Paul VI offers a curriculum which is designed either to prepare students to meet the requirements of leading colleges and universities or to pursue a business career after graduation. For college preparation, it is recommended that a student develop a program that includes the specific requirement of the college of his/her choice. Grades, class rank, SAT scores, and recommendations are important for college entrance. In the business curriculum, courses are designed to provide training in basic skills and attitudes to succeed in the business world.
